Prisons: Smoke Alarms

Asked by Ben Obese-JectyConservativeMinistry of JusticeTabled Answered 8 September 2026UIN 23221

The question

To ask the Secretary of State for Justice, how many cells across the prison estate are not in use owing to not having a smoke alarm.

Answered by Ministry of Justice

No prison cells are currently out of use owing to absence of fire detection equipment. Prison cells either have in-cell automatic fire detection, or domestic smoke detectors which are placed immediately outside cell doors.
